Quoting the dictionary: "Behaviors are resolved by LiveCode immediately after loading a stack file"
Does that mean there is no opportunity to write a script to point LC to an external library file containing behavior scripts? I have been unsuccessful trying to do that in preOpenStack of the main stack or preOpenCard of a card in the main stack. The only way I have found to do this is by setting the stackfiles property of the main stack to point to my behavior library. Even then, I have to exit LC and rerun for that to take effect. My behavior references do not include the fully qualified stack file name, they are of the form "button ID of stack "behaviorstack". This is because I want the flexibility of using separate versions of the behaviors for development and live apps.
